What is a Tensile Testing Machine?

A tensile testing machine, also known as a universal testing machine (UTM), measures the force required to break or elongate a material. By applying a controlled tension, the machine evaluates the mechanical properties of the material, such as tensile strength, elongation, and modulus of elasticity. This information is vital for understanding how materials will perform under different types of stress.

Applications of Tensile Testing Machines

Tensile testing machines are used across various industries to ensure the quality and reliability of materials:

  • Manufacturing: Ensuring raw materials and finished products meet specified strength requirements.
  • Automotive: Testing the durability and performance of components under stress.
  • Aerospace: Evaluating materials used in aircraft and spacecraft to ensure they can withstand extreme conditions.
  • Construction: Verifying the strength of materials used in building structures to ensure safety and compliance with regulations.

How to Choose the Right Tensile Testing Machine

Selecting the right tensile testing machine depends on several factors:

  • Material Type : Consider the types of materials you need to test. Different machines may be better suited for metals, polymers, textiles, or composites.
  • Test Requirements : Determine the specific tests you need to perform, such as tensile strength, elongation, or modulus of elasticity.
  • Capacity : Ensure the machine can handle the maximum load required for your tests.
  • Environment : Consider the conditions in which the machine will operate. Some machines are designed for use in laboratory environments, while others are built for industrial settings.
